Captain Grey and his crew of sky pirates have a reputation for doing the impossible. From breaking into high-security military research facilities to conning the iCity elite-there isn't a lock they can't pick, a safe they can't break, or a hidden treasure they can't find. Until now. Returning from a harrowing heist involving a neon battery and a trash shoot, Grey and his crew are approached by Dalia, the immortal daughter of the infamous ArchGovernor-and she has an offer. The job? Locate and steal the Stones of Indigo-seven fabled rocks invested with godlike power. The search for the first stone is a bonified treasure hunt, guided by an ancient map to a deadly, uncharted island that's protected by a mysterious guardian. The score? One million credits per crew member, per stone. The catch? Well, that's where things get a little complicated. The stones don't exist. They're a myth. A bedtime story told to little pirates to make them believe that power and wealth are attainable if you just work hard enough. ...
